The Nissan Diesel Space Dream (Kana: 日産ディーゼル・スペースドリーム) is a heavy-duty double-deck tourist coach built by Nissan Diesel.

Space Dream (1983-1988)[]

The Space Dream was introduced at the 1983 Tokyo Motor Show, where it was fitted with a Fuji Heavy Industries body. The engine that was used in the Space Dream at this time was:

  • P-GA66T (1984) - RE10 engine

Jonckheere-bodied double-decker bus (1993-2000)[]

The Nissan Diesel second generation double-decker bus was introduced in 1993, with a new double-decker bus chassis, which was developed from Nissan Diesel Space Wing tri-axle, the new generation bus was fitted with Jonckheere Monaco body.

The engines that were used during this time were:

  • RG620VBN (1993) - RF10 engine
  • RG550VBN (1995) - RH8 engine
